Advanced Fertility Treatments: Exploring Options and Outcomes

Infertility can be a painful experience, but thankfully, advanced fertility treatments offer solutions for individuals and couples wanting to start their families. These treatments range from established methods like in vitro fertilization (IVF) to more approaches such as egg preservation and genetic screening. Understanding the diverse options available is crucial for making informed decisions about your fertility journey.

It's important to consult a fertility specialist who can assess your unique needs and suggest the most appropriate treatment plan.

Outcomes differ depending on a number of factors, including age, health issues, and the kind of fertility treatment utilized. Although success rates can be influenced by these factors, advancements in fertility technology have led to remarkable improvements in outcomes over the years.

Fertility Medications: Optimizing Your Chances of Conception

Undergoing assisted reproductive technology can be a challenging journey, but understanding how reproductive drugs work is crucial for maximizing your chances of success. These medications aim to increase egg production, balance your menstrual cycle, and prepare the uterus for implantation. Consulting with a expert in reproductive health is essential to determine the best course of treatment based on your individual needs and questions to ask fertility specialist on first visit medical history.

There are numerous fertility drugs on the market, each with its own mechanism of action. Some common types include ovulation induction medications which stimulate ovulation in women with PCOS or irregular cycles, and gonadotropins like follitropin which are injected to increase the number of eggs produced.
